The Company is a global leader in provision of integrated healthcare services across strategic consulting, benchmarking, commercialisation, customer engagement, events, marketing and communications.
The Company is a network of diverse industry specialists, connected by science, strategy and imagination, working with a wide range of pharma, healthcare and biotech companies.
The Company has grown both organically and through major acquisition in many countries and over several key service offerings.Reporting to the Global Process Owner Record to Report (GPO RTR), the RTR Team Lead role manages the RTR senior accountants in one of two shared service locations (Yardley, Pennsylvania and Manchester, United Kingdom).
This is a key FSSC management role working directly with finance teams in the local business to ensure a high-quality service is delivered, as detailed in the service level agreements.
Alongside the people management duties for their direct reports and delivering timely and accurate monthly reporting for all the FSSC supported legal entities, the RTR Team Leads will take responsibility for the preparation and timely and regular execution of KPI reporting; Service Level Agreement reviews and delivery of any resulting actions as well as acting as reviewer and approver for balance sheet reconciliations and General Ledger (GL) journal postings.
Manage the performance of direct reports by developing accountabilities, establishing performance objectives, providing career counselling, feedback, and guidance, and ensuring that all policies are understood and adhered toSupport a culture of high performance, healthy collaboration, and rapid development by setting high expectations for staff, providing opportunities for development, personally providing feedback and coaching to teammates, and recognition/reward for high performance
Identify training needs across the team and organise regular upskilling sessions to eliminate single points of failure within the processes owned by FSSC
Responsible for the timely delivery of accurate month end reporting for the business units supported by the FSSC and the reporting and improvement of key performance indicators for the RTR process
Ensures compliance (SOX or otherwise) of the RTR function, including identifying and managing fraud risks, ensuring segregation of duties, facilitating audits, and reviewing the occurrence of non-standardized processes and activities
Ensure all reconciliations are completed and reviewed in line with the policy on a regular basis. Participate in strategic continuous improvement initiatives in the organization, achieving identified goals (financial, process or talent)
Promptly respond to information requests from internal and external stakeholders and act as a coordination point for internal and external audits, controls testing and year end audit procedures.
People Management responsibilitiesStrong customer service focus with commitment to building professional, responsive and effective relationships to ensure the business objectives of the organisation are met and exceeded where possible.
Manages complex accounting, internal controls, financial systems, and processesBachelor ́s Degree in Accounting, Finance, Business Administration, or another related field
Experienced people manager with at least 5 years of experience in a related finance, Record to Report management role
Knowledge of IFRS or US GAAP and experience with controls – including testing and compliance reporting
Demonstrates flexibility via the ability to shift priorities quickly, while maintaining organization and control
Ability to work and communicate with various levels within the organization, including members of the senior leadership team to present issues and recommendations in a clear and concise manner and to engage the right people in the organisation to ensure objectives are met.
